I don't understand this at all everyone is saying to go to the "upload video page" but I don't see that anywhere! What am I doing wrong? I've got FTP and I have NO IDEA what to do... please someone help me....
Return to Site Help & Feedback
Users browsing this forum: No registered users and 1 guest